205049 2004-01-03 11:32:00 I have a new Panasonic Laser printer KX-p7100 , which is jamming every time I use it. This happens whether I use the front output or the back.
The problem seems to be related to a small black peg behind the back door. The file prints OK, but on the way out the paper hits this black peg and jams up. There are two positions for this peg. (1) on top of a white plastic block or(2) below it. No matter which position I use the jams occur.
Can anyone put me right on this?

205050 2004-01-03 18:58:00 Are you sure this plastic peg wasn't just used as some kind of support mechanism during transportation, which requires it to be removed before printing? Try the troubleshooting section of the users manual and see if it says anything there.

Also, damp (or even just slightly damp) paper can jam printers, so that might be a possiblity (although in your case, and with recent weather, probably unlikely).
